Apple fans freak out on social media after Apple delays buggy Watch operating system

Apple Watch fans have taken to Twitter in outrage over Apple’s last-minute move to delay the buggy operating system update.

For Apple Watch users, it was like waking up on Christmas Day and finding a note from Santa saying something else had come up.

Since Apple’s WWDC conference in June when Apple CEO Tim Cook unveiled watchOS 2, people who were among the first to buy the Apple smartwatch have looked forward to the improvements the new operating system promised.

With watchOS 2, app developers can make more sophisticated apps that use the full features of the watch. The Watch apps are about to be quicker, better and more featured.

But just not yet.

Last week, at the “monster” Apple event in San Francisco, Apple announced the watchOS 2 would be released on September 16 — the same day as the iOS 9 update for iPhones and iPads.

But just before the software was due to go out, Apple released a statement saying it had been delayed to another time.

In the lead up to the launch of the software, app developers working with pre-release versions of the Watch operating system complained that the software was draining the Watch’s battery at an extraordinary rate. Some said the software wasn’t ready for release.

The reaction from fans was disappointment, outrage and disbelief, all expressed in tweets of 140 characters or less.
